What does chambermaid mean? - Definitions. net A chambermaid is an employee, usually a woman, who is responsible for cleaning, maintaining, and taking care of bedrooms in a hotel, guest house, or a similar establishment Their tasks can include changing bed linen, cleaning bathrooms, refilling supplies, and sometimes delivering room services
